    Factors Affecting Honda HRV Price in Indonesia

    Several key factors influence the Honda HRV price in Indonesia, and understanding these can help you make a more informed purchasing decision. Here's a breakdown:

    • Trim Level: The Honda HRV is available in various trim levels, each offering a different set of features and specifications. Generally, the higher the trim level, the more expensive the car. Common trim levels include the E, S, SE and the top-of-the-line RS. Each trim adds different levels of features, like enhanced safety tech, premium audio systems, and fancier interior finishes. Knowing which trim level suits your needs and budget is the first step.
    • Engine Options: The Honda HRV typically offers different engine options, such as a 1.5L or 1.8L engine, depending on the market. The engine choice can impact the price, with larger, more powerful engines usually commanding a higher price tag. In Indonesia, the 1.5L engine is more common, balancing performance and fuel efficiency nicely. Make sure to compare the available engines and choose the one that best fits your driving style.
    • Transmission: You'll usually find both manual and automatic transmission options available. Automatic transmissions generally add to the overall price of the vehicle due to their added convenience and technology. While manual transmissions might save you some money upfront, consider the driving conditions in your area and whether the ease of an automatic is worth the extra cost.
    • Features and Options: Additional features and options, such as leather seats, sunroofs, advanced safety systems, and infotainment upgrades, can significantly impact the final price. These extras enhance the driving experience but also add to the overall investment. Think about which features are essential for you and which ones you can live without to stay within your budget.
    • Location: Car prices can vary slightly depending on the region or city in Indonesia. This is often due to transportation costs, local taxes, and regional incentives. Prices in Jakarta might differ slightly from those in Surabaya, for example. It's worth checking with dealerships in your area to get the most accurate pricing information.
    • Dealer Markups: Dealerships can add their own markups to the base price, so it's wise to shop around and compare offers from different dealers. Don't be afraid to negotiate! Building a good rapport with the salesperson can sometimes lead to better deals.
    • Government Taxes and Fees: The Indonesian government imposes various taxes and fees on new vehicles, including Value Added Tax (VAT) and Luxury Goods Sales Tax (LST). These taxes can significantly impact the overall price, so it's essential to factor them into your budget. Keep an eye on any potential changes in tax policies that could affect car prices.

    Current Price Range of Honda HRV in Indonesia

    Alright, let's get down to the nitty-gritty: the actual price range! As of late 2024, the Honda HRV in Indonesia typically ranges from IDR 375,900,000 to IDR 532,500,000. Keep in mind that these are starting prices and can vary based on the factors we discussed earlier. To provide a clearer picture, here's a general idea of the price range for each trim level:

    • Honda HRV S: Starting from IDR 375,900,000. This is the base model, offering essential features and Honda's reliable performance. It's a great option for those looking for value.
    • Honda HRV E: Expect to pay upwards of IDR 399,900,000. The E trim adds some extra comforts and conveniences, making it a popular mid-range choice.
    • Honda HRV SE: Prices for the SE trim usually begin around IDR 423,300,000. You'll get even more features, including enhanced styling and tech upgrades.
    • Honda HRV RS: The top-of-the-line RS trim can set you back around IDR 532,500,000 or more. This model boasts all the bells and whistles, including a sporty design, advanced safety features, and a premium interior.

    Note: These prices are approximate and may vary. Always check with your local Honda dealer for the most up-to-date and accurate pricing information.

    Tips for Finding the Best Deals on a Honda HRV

    Want to score the best possible deal on your new Honda HRV? Here are some tried-and-true tips to help you save some serious cash:

    1. Do Your Research: Arm yourself with knowledge! Understand the different trim levels, features, and options available. Compare prices from multiple dealerships to get a sense of the average cost. Use online resources and car comparison websites to gather information.
    2. Shop Around: Don't settle for the first offer you receive. Visit multiple dealerships and compare their prices, financing options, and trade-in values. Let them know you're shopping around – this can encourage them to offer you a better deal.
    3. Negotiate: Don't be afraid to haggle! Dealerships often have some wiggle room in their pricing. Negotiate the price, financing terms, and any additional fees. Be polite but firm, and be prepared to walk away if you're not happy with the offer.
    4. Consider Financing Options: Explore different financing options, such as loans from banks, credit unions, or the dealership. Compare interest rates, loan terms, and monthly payments to find the best fit for your budget. Sometimes, manufacturer-backed financing deals can offer attractive rates.
    5. Take Advantage of Promotions: Keep an eye out for special promotions, incentives, and rebates offered by Honda or the dealerships. These can include discounts, low-interest financing, or free accessories. Check the Honda Indonesia website or inquire with your local dealer about current promotions.
    6. Time Your Purchase: Consider purchasing your Honda HRV at the end of the month, quarter, or year. Dealerships often have sales quotas to meet, and they may be more willing to offer discounts to close deals. Also, keep an eye out for year-end clearance sales when dealerships are trying to clear out older models to make room for new inventory.
    7. Trade-In Strategically: If you have a car to trade in, research its market value beforehand. Get quotes from multiple dealerships and compare them. Negotiate the trade-in value separately from the price of the new car to ensure you're getting a fair deal.
    8. Be Flexible with Options: If you're on a tight budget, consider opting for a lower trim level or foregoing some of the optional features. You can always add accessories later if you decide you need them.
